The International Year Zero - Computing, Engineering, Mathematical Sciences at the University of Kent International College is your essential pathway to a rewarding undergraduate degree. This foundation programme is designed for ambitious students aiming to build a strong academic base in critical STEM fields. You will explore core concepts in Maths, Data Analysis and Statistics, Digital Design, and Introduction to Computer Science and Programming, gaining the foundational knowledge and skills necessary for success in your chosen higher-level studies. It provides a comprehensive introduction to the disciplines that underpin technological advancement and scientific discovery.
This full-time, on-campus programme is delivered over two semesters, providing an intensive and supportive learning environment.
